noun
- nonsense; rubbish; something regarded as foolish or untrue
Usage: British informal; usually plural or used as uncountable
Examples
- That's complete codswallops—I don't believe a word of it.
- He was talking codswallops about his supposed adventures.
- Don't listen to their codswallops; they're just making things up.
- The article was full of codswallops and misinformation.
- She dismissed his excuses as codswallops.
